Highgate – Alice L. Wiegand, 81, passed away on Tuesday, February 24, 2009, at the home of her son and daughter-in-law, Gerald and Sheila Wiegand. At her bedside was her loving family. Born on July 31, 1927, in Holyoke, Colorado, Alice was the daughter of the late Fred and Nellie (Gehringer) Fiedler. Alice was preceded in death by her husband, Gerald H. Wiegand on October 22, 1974. Alice for several years was employed by the Frigidaire Company. She enjoyed doing puzzle books, needle point and latch hooking. Most of all she enjoyed being with her family. Survivors include her sons, Gerald Wiegand and his wife, Sheila ,of Highgate; Kenneth Wiegand and his wife, Roxanne, of Meridian, Mississippi and Jon Wiegand and his wife, Elaine, of Motley, Minnesota; her daughters, Patricia Holtz and her husband, Daryl of Arizona; Laura Muellner and her husband, Gordon of St. Cloud, Minnesota and Elizabeth Casper of Washington; her grandchildren, Jeremy, Allan, Patrick, Kelly, Corey, Matthew, Joshua and her great grandsons, Jacob, Devon and Dante all of Highgate. Alice is also survived by fifteen grandchildren, many great grandchildren; her brothers, Vern Fiedler and his wife, Esther, of Rice, Minnesota and Ernest Fiedler of Phoenix, Arizona; her brother -in-law, Robert Anderson of Minnesota; a special nephew, Marvin Anderson and his wife, Jackie of Wake Park, Minnesota and several other nieces and nephews. In addition to her parents and husband, Gerald, Alice was preceded in death by her sister, Ida Mae Anderson and a brother and his wife, John and Carol Fiedler. A celebration of Alice’s life will be held at the home of Gerald and Sheila Wiegand, 1704 Carter Hill Road in Highgate on Thursday, February 26, 2009, from 3 to 7 PM. Interment will be this spring in the Woodlawn Cemetery in Annandale, Minnesota. Those planning an expression of sympathy are asked to consider the Missisquoi Valley Rescue, Inc., P.O.
